Irving Fryar catches a Hail Mary from Tony Eason for the winning touchdown to spoil Jim Everett's NFL debut. November 16, 1986.

@threerings1345
@threerings1345 5 жыл бұрын
On this play Eason did a smart thing by throwing the ball with a great deal of arc even though the "hail mary" was inside the Rams' 30 yd line. Many of today's QBs just zero in on one covered target instead of getting air under the ball on medium range last second passes. This allows multiple receivers to maneuver into good position for the "tip drill" like Morgan and Fryar executed to perfection here.

This loss ultimately cost the Rams an NFC West title and a home playoff game as they finished 10-6 just behind San Francisco who finished 10-5-1. The Rams went out in the Wild Card round to the Redskins while San Francisco was blasted by the Giants in the divisional round.
